package mindustry.editor; import arc.struct.*; import mindustry.annotations.Annotations.*; import mindustry.game.*; import mindustry.gen.*; import mindustry.world.*; import mindustry.world.blocks.environment.*; import static mindustry.Vars.*; public class DrawOperation{ private LongSeq array = new LongSeq(); public boolean isEmpty(){ return array.isEmpty(); } public void addOperation(long op){ array.add(op); } public void undo(){ for(int i = array.size - 1; i >= 0; i--){ updateTile(i); } } public void redo(){ for(int i = 0; i < array.size; i++){ updateTile(i); } } private void updateTile(int i){ long l = array.get(i); array.set(i, TileOp.get(TileOp.x(l), TileOp.y(l), TileOp.type(l), getTile(editor.tile(TileOp.x(l), TileOp.y(l)), TileOp.type(l)))); setTile(editor.tile(TileOp.x(l), TileOp.y(l)), TileOp.type(l), TileOp.value(l)); } short getTile(Tile tile, byte type){ if(type == OpType.floor.ordinal()){ return tile.floorID(); }else if(type == OpType.block.ordinal()){ return tile.blockID(); }else if(type == OpType.rotation.ordinal()){ return tile.build == null ? 0 : (byte)tile.build.rotation; }else if(type == OpType.team.ordinal()){ return (byte)tile.getTeamID(); }else if(type == OpType.overlay.ordinal()){ return tile.overlayID(); } throw new IllegalArgumentException("Invalid type."); } void setTile(Tile tile, byte type, short to){ editor.load(() -> { if(type == OpType.floor.ordinal()){ if(content.block(to) instanceof Floor floor){ tile.setFloor(floor); } }else if(type == OpType.block.ordinal()){ tile.getLinkedTiles(t -> editor.renderer.updatePoint(t.x, t.y)); Block block = content.block(to); tile.setBlock(block, tile.team(), tile.build == null ? 0 : tile.build.rotation); tile.getLinkedTiles(t -> editor.renderer.updatePoint(t.x, t.y)); }else if(type == OpType.rotation.ordinal()){ if(tile.build != null) tile.build.rotation = to; }else if(type == OpType.team.ordinal()){ tile.setTeam(Team.get(to)); }else if(type == OpType.overlay.ordinal()){ tile.setOverlayID(to); } }); editor.renderer.updatePoint(tile.x, tile.y); } @Struct class TileOpStruct{ short x; short y; byte type; short value; } public enum OpType{ floor, block, rotation, team, overlay } }
